Transaction 86fc2bd3da6cf3a115cf1e728a84060f01e116086778a7245e6ea14e5becd9c5
1 Input
1 Output
-
86fc2bd3da6cf3a115cf1e728a84060f01e116086778a7245e6ea14e5becd9c5:0
- value
- 658557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 878991d32335d9c17babeafd617f210b54e84614 OP_EQUAL
- address
- 3E3fwwqDDbsMQnZ9aJApTuikAByaQKFJKH